Troubleshooting
Symptom Cause Remedial action
No clay is extruded.
There is not enough clay.
Add clay until the case is lled with that clay.
The clay in the case is too soft. Since the clay is soft, add slightly hard clay.
The clay in the nozzle is hard. Remove the clay in the nozzle.
Rough-surfaced clay keeps
coming out of the extruding slot..
Dry clay is stuck in the end of the nozzle
(cylindrical part).
Clean the inside of the nozzle.
Clay is extruded as it rotates.
Clay is too soft.
Add some leather hard clay or open the
hopper cover for a while to help dry the clay.
Clay is not properly de-aired. De-air the clay.
The extruded clay has holes.
There is too much clay or the air remains in the
end of the nozzle (cylindrical part) because the
nozzle is clogged with clay.
Remove some clay.
Remove some clay from the nozzle.
The screw stops.The circuit
breaker trips.
Clay is hard during mixing. Add water to make the clay softer.
A large clay lump is caught between the screw
and the case.
Remove the clay lump.
There is too much clay. Remove some clay
The clay in the nozzle
becomes hard.
The clay in the nozzle is dried. Clean the nozzle by removing it.
The vacuum pressure is low.
The vacuum gauge reading
does not increase.
The vacuum gauge reading does not increase
even if the air inlet is covered with ngers.
→The tube comes o󰀨 or the tube is torn.
Connect the tube or replace the tube.
The vacuum gauge reading increases if the
air inlet is covered with ngers.
→A)The gap between the hopper cover and the
barrel becomes larger.
→B)The lter is clogged.
A)Use wet cloth, or the like, to clean the
mating surfaces of the case and the
hopper cover.
B)Clean the lter.
Clay is not de-aired.
The air inlet is clogged with clay.
Before de-airing, clean the air inlet and
its peripheral area. If the air inlet is still
clogged with clay during mixing, there is
too much clay. Remove some clay.
De-airing time was too short. Extend the mixing time in vacuum.
Clay comes up to the vacuum
chamber.
There is too much clay.
Remove the vacuum chamber cover (acrylic
plate) and remove clay.
The vacuum pump is not
operating properly.
The hopper case is already vacuumed, preventing
the pump valve from being actuated.
The vacuum pump may stop working when
the hopper case is already vacuumed.
Open the pressure relief valve to pressurize
the hopper then start the operating the
vacuum.
The hopper cover will not
open even if the pressure
relief valve is opened.
The air inlet is clogged with clay, keeping the
hopper case vacuumed.
Insert a thin rod or the like from the nozzle
end to allow air to ow into the hopper
case.
